We establish the existence of a weak solution u of the semilinear wave equation
where a(t, x) is equal to 1 outside a compact set with respect to x and a non-linear term f k which satisfies |f k (u)| β€ C |u | k . For some non-trapping time- periodic perturbations a(t, x), we obtain the long time existence of a solution from little initial data.
